Social Casinos: The Free-to-Play Playground

What Are They?

Social casinos are essentially free-to-play platforms that offer casino-style games. Think slots, poker, blackjack, roulette – the whole shebang. The key difference? You play with virtual currency, not real money. You might start with a stash of free chips, and then earn more through daily bonuses, completing challenges, or purchasing them. The goal isn’t to win real cash; it’s about entertainment and social interaction.

Pros and Cons for the Experienced Gambler

  • Pros:
    • Risk-Free Practice: This is the biggest draw. You can test new strategies, learn the rules of unfamiliar games, or simply unwind without worrying about losing your hard-earned forints.
    • Accessibility: Social casinos are often available on multiple platforms – web browsers, mobile apps – and are generally easy to access.
    • Social Interaction: Many social casinos incorporate social features, allowing you to connect with friends, compete in tournaments, and share your wins (and losses).
    • No Financial Risk: This is a significant advantage, especially if you’re on a tight budget or want to avoid the potential downsides of real-money gambling.
  • Cons:
    • No Real Rewards: While you might win virtual chips, you can’t cash them out. The thrill of winning real money is absent.
    • Potential for Spending: Some social casinos aggressively push in-app purchases. It’s easy to get carried away and spend more than you intended on virtual currency.
    • Limited Strategy Application: The algorithms and game mechanics in social casinos may differ from real-money platforms, so strategies that work in one might not translate to the other.
    • Lack of Regulatory Oversight: Social casinos are often less regulated than real-money platforms, which means there’s less protection for players.

Real Money Casinos: Where the Stakes are Real

What Are They?

These are the traditional online casinos where you wager real money with the potential to win real money. They offer a vast selection of games, from slots and table games to live dealer experiences. They require you to deposit funds, and any winnings are yours to withdraw (subject to certain terms and conditions).

Pros and Cons for the Experienced Gambler

  • Pros:
    • Real Rewards: The potential to win actual money is the main appeal. The thrill of a big win and the satisfaction of cashing out are unmatched.
    • Higher Stakes: If you’re a high roller, real-money casinos offer higher betting limits, allowing you to chase bigger wins.
    • More Game Variety: Real-money casinos often have a wider selection of games, including progressive jackpots and live dealer games.
    • Strategic Depth: The games are generally designed to be more complex and offer more opportunities for strategic play.
  • Cons:
    • Financial Risk: You can lose money. This is the biggest downside, and it’s crucial to gamble responsibly.
    • Potential for Addiction: The excitement and potential for reward can be addictive. It’s important to set limits and stick to them.
    • Regulation and Security Concerns: While regulated casinos offer a degree of protection, it’s essential to choose reputable platforms to ensure fair play and secure transactions.
    • Tax Implications: Winnings may be subject to taxes, depending on Hungarian laws.
